Guide to Understanding Window Films and Their Uses

A variety of window films are available that will help you improve the appearance of your office building or house, reduce your energy bills and offer you privacy. There are specialized window films that provide protection from ultraviolet (UVA+B) rays of the sun. Some window films provide added insulation which helps control the temperature of a room’s interior. Here are the most commonly used window film types.

UV window films

You can reduce fading of your wooden floors, furniture, carpet and draperies by installing UV window films. The films reduce up to 99% exposure to UV radiation and help prevent deterioration of textiles.

Window films for privacy

These films are best for offices and homes that need.to reduce or block visibility. Privacy films for homes maximize privacy to areas such as shower enclosures and front doors, bathrooms and interior glass doors to closets. For business, the use of these films on glass partitions and walls is very popular.

Safety and security films

Installation of safety and security film makes a glass shatter resistant. It provides protection from broken glass when impacted and damaged. Engineered with powerful adhesives, security films reduce the hazards of broken glass by keeping pieces safely attached to the film. In addition to this, the film can provide protection from intruders by holding the glass pieces intact in the frame.

Solar control films

Up to 80 % of the total heat gain of the sun can be reduced by installing solar control window film. Energy efficiency of a building can be improved by installing solar control window film. In addition to this, problematic hot/and cold spots in a building can be evened out effectively by installing solar control film.
